Chlorophyll
A green pigment found in the chloroplasts of plants and algae, responsible for the absorption of light to provide energy for photosynthesis.
Anthocyanins
Class of red water-soluble plant pigments.
Petiole
The stalk that attaches the leaf blade to the stem in vascular plants, enabling nutrient and water transport between the leaf and the rest of the plant.
Abscission Zone
The area at the base of the petiole where the leaf will break away from the stem. Also known as the abscission layer.
